Position Description: This senior business analyst and process consultant position is in the Child and Family Services Agency (CFSA) and will support the development of a new technology platform for the agency to implement a new comprehensive child welfare information system (CCWIS). As a business analyst and process consultant you will support the assessment of current systems and processes and then develop requirements process flows user stories and wireframes for the future platform. The business analyst and process consultant will also participate in testing efforts and rollout activities.
